“The law of retaliation was implemented this morning against attackers at the Azerbaijani embassy in Tehran,” the judiciary said on Wednesday.
In January 2023, the man shot one person dead and injured two others after entering the Azerbaijan embassy in Iran’s capital, the report reported.
After the attack, Azerbaijan’s relations with Iran became tense as Baku closed the embassy and evacuated more evacuated staff than what was called “terrorist acts.”
The first Iranian investigation found that the attack was motivated by “personal and family-related issues.”
In mid-2024, Azerbaijan reopened its embassy after the court sentenced the perpetrator to death.
President Masuud Pezeschkian visited Baku later last month as the two countries strengthened bilateral relations.
The two countries also held joint military training in November and earlier this month.
